The clinical significance of D-dimer concentrations in patients with gestational hypertensive disorders according to the severity.

Se Jeong KimHyo Jeong AhnJung Yeon ParkByoung Jae KimKyu Ri HwangTaek Sang LeeHye Won JeonSun Min Kim
Published in: Obstetrics & gynecology science (2017)
Maternal concentrations of d-dimer were significantly elevated in patients with severe features than those without severe features among those with GHD. Some pregnant women with GHD can have markedly elevated concentrations of d-dimer without any evidence of current VTE.
